This was a bit of a miscomm. The idea is that you would be rewarded for trying to use LFG to form a group. A separate feature of LFG is that we allow players to identify whether they are comfortable leading the group or not and then we try to make sure each group has at least one leader. You are probably going to have a much worse experience joining a pug of 5 players when none of them know anything about the encounters.
